Directed by Sudesh Wasantha Pieris and written by Sunil Soma Peiris, Mamath Gahaniyak features a cast that includes Roger Seneviratne , Anusha Sonali , and W. Jayasiri . The film is categorized as a drama and earned an 8.2/10 rating from users on IMDb .
